Relax into summer with movies and live music on Fairhaven Village Green! This year’s Outdoor Cinema is in full swing with “Perfect Pairing” features and live music to enjoy alongside classic concession stand fare. Fairhaven Association Executive Director Heather Carter sat down with WhatcomTalk to bring local film buffs up to speed.

A Little More Action

After a few years of COVID growing pains, the Outdoor Cinema is once again regaling Historic Fairhaven with titans of the silver screen, set up for everyone to enjoy on the Village Green.

“Epic Events did the Fairhaven Outdoor Cinema for several years, then it went on a hiatus during COVID,” Carter says. “Then, they reached out to the Fairhaven Association to take it over, so we took it over as our event series last year. We partner with Epic Events. They do all the technical side, and we do all the marketing and creative side.”

“We’re doing a thing called ‘Perfect Pairings’ this season, a themed pair of movies on back-to-back weekends,” she says. “Our opening weekend was ‘Top Gun’and we’re doing ‘Top Gun: Maverick’ to follow.’ Another weekend, we’re doing ‘Finding Nemo,’ and then the next weekend we’re doing ‘Mama Mia’ — like a beach theme.”

Tickets and Concessions

Each ticket purchased goes toward the screening as well as live entertainment prior to the film. “Live music will start, typically, about two hours before the movie and we have a different artist each week,” says Carter.

Tickets are $7 a person if paying in cash and $8 a person if paying via credit card. Kids four and under are free and concession stand tickets are available for $3 each. “Concessions are popcorn, soda, candy, and water,” says Carter.

All proceeds from the Outdoor Cinema series go to benefit the Fairhaven Association and its mission to support and enrich the community through elevating small businesses and encouraging tourism. “All of these proceeds go back into ongoing programs and events in Fairhaven,” says Carter.

Zero-Waste Bins

Sustainable Connections has installed zero-waste bins throughout the green, promoting proper disposal of trash and waste. “We’ve noticed in the first few weeks of showings that people are just being a little clumsy with their garbage,” Carter says. “We want to communicate, with kindness, that if you’re bringing in your garbage, please make sure you take it out or use the appropriate zero-waste bins. There are garbage bins at all the entrances and exits of the green.”

The 2023 Summer Outdoor Cinema Lineup

June 24: Top Gun with live entertainment from the Brie Mueller Band

July 1: Top Gun: Maverick with live entertainment from Bayou Opossums

July 8: Finding Nemo with live entertainment from the Song Wranglers

July 15: Mamma Mia with live entertainment from the Quickdraw String Band

July 22: Black Panther with live entertainment from K-Kats

July 29: Black Panther: Wakanda Forever with live entertainment from Rose Aiko

August 5: A League of Their Own with entertainment from D’Vas

August 12: Field of Dreams with live entertainment from Cardova

August 19: The Princess and the Frog with live entertainment from Guitars and Gratitude

August 26: The Princess Bride with live entertainment from Birdhouse
